Introduction


Common management admission test (CMAT) is a national level management entrance examination for admission to various management institutions located in India. Before 2019, the exam was conducted by AICTE, however, with the establishment of NTA, the responsibility was shifted to the latter. By clearing NTA CMAT 2020, the candidates become eligible to apply for PGDM, MBA, PGCM & Executive PGDM in AICTE recognized institutes. The official notification for NTA CMAT 2022 is has been released on 16 February 2022.

As of CMAT- 2021, a total number of 71490 candidates were registered for this examination. 52327 candidates appeared for the examination. The Examination was conducted in 153 Cities in 278 Centres.

NTA CMAT 2022 Exam Pattern


The CMAT exam pattern can be described as follows:

Mode of exam

The exam will be conducted in online mode.  

Exam Duration

The candidates get 180 minutes (3 hours) to answer the questions.

Type of Questions

There will be Multiple Choice Questions (MCQ).

Total Marks

 400 marks will be allotted totally

Total Number of Questions

There will be a total of 100 questions divided among 5 sections:

  • Quantitative techniques and data interpretation,
  • Logical Reasoning,
  • Language comprehension and
  • General awareness
  • Innovation and Entrepreneurship (Optional)

Marking Scheme

+4 marks will be allotted for each correct answer and1 mark will be deducted for each wrong answer.

Un-answered/un-attempted will be given no marks.

Sections

SectionQuestionsTotal marks
Quantitative techniques and data interpretation2080
Logical Reasoning2080
Language Comprehension2080
General awareness2080
Innovation and Entrepreneurship (Optional)2080
Total100400

CMAT Counseling


Unlike other mammoth entrance exams, CMAT doesn’t have a common counseling (central counseling) conducted by the NTA. Every institute has its own admission criteria and a separate admission process.

NTA CMAT counseling season dates will be notified later with institutes announcing their own application forms. The applicants have to register themselves on the particular institution website for taking part in the admission process.

Fortunately, much like other management colleges, the admission to CMAT accepting institutes also include following steps:

  • Registering for colleges based on CMAT scores
  • Group Discussion (GD)
  • Writing Ability Test (WAT)
  • Personal Interviews (PI).

However, the process may differ from institute to institute.
